91亚洲精品一区二区乱码_国产精品久久久久久久_精品国产91久久久久久老师_国产美女精品视频免费播放软件_日韩欧美国产成人_亚洲aⅴ网站_亚洲另类在线一区_黄毛片在线观看_久久久精品国产免大香伊 _北岛玲精品视频在线观看

您的位置:首頁 > 教程筆記 > 綜合教程

Golang數據轉換方法:掌握數據轉換的核心技術,輕松應對各種場景

2024-02-24 18:44:35 綜合教程 197

Golang數據轉換方法:掌握數據轉換的核心技術,輕松應對各種場景,需要具體代碼示例

在Golang開發中,數據轉換是一個非常常見的操作。無論是將數據格式轉換成另一種格式,還是將數據類型轉換成另一種類型,都需要借助一些技術手段來實現。數據轉換的質量和效率直接影響著程序的性能和穩定性。因此,掌握數據轉換的核心技術是非常重要的。

本文將介紹一些常用的Golang數據轉換方法,通過具體的代碼示例來幫助讀者更好地理解和掌握這些技術。

1. 字符串和整數之間的轉換

在Golang中,字符串和整數之間的相互轉換是比較常見的操作。下面是一個將字符串轉換為整數的示例代碼:

package main

import (
    "fmt"
    "strconv"
)

func main() {
    str := "123"
    num, err := strconv.Atoi(str)
    if err != nil {
        fmt.Println("轉換失敗:", err)
        return
    }
    fmt.Println(num)
}

上面的代碼中,通過函數可以將字符串轉換為整數,如果轉換失敗,則會返回一個錯誤。

同樣地,如果要將整數轉換為字符串,可以使用函數:

package main

import (
    "fmt"
    "strconv"
)

func main() {
    num := 123
    str := strconv.Itoa(num)
    fmt.Println(str)
}
2. 結構體和JSON之間的轉換

在Golang中,結構體和JSON之間的轉換也是比較常見的操作。下面是一個將結構體轉換為JSON字符串的示例代碼:

package main

import (
    "encoding/json"
    "fmt"
)

type Person struct {
    Name string `json:"name"`
    Age  int    `json:"age"`
}

func main() {
    person := Person{Name: "Alice", Age: 25}
    jsonStr, err := json.Marshal(person)
    if err != nil {
        fmt.Println("轉換失敗:", err)
        return
    }
    fmt.Println(string(jsonStr))
}

上面的代碼中,通過函數可以將結構體轉換為JSON字符串。

如果要將JSON字符串轉換為結構體,可以使用函數:

package main

import (
    "encoding/json"
    "fmt"
)

type Person struct {
    Name string `json:"name"`
    Age  int    `json:"age"`
}

func main() {
    jsonStr := `{"name":"Bob","age":30}`
    var person Person
    err := json.Unmarshal([]byte(jsonStr), &person)
    if err != nil {
        fmt.Println("轉換失敗:", err)
        return
    }
    fmt.Println(person)
}
3. 接口類型斷言

在Golang中,接口是一種非常靈活的數據類型,經常用于實現數據的多態。但是在使用接口時,有時候需要將接口轉換為具體的類型。這時可以使用接口類型斷言來實現:

package main

import "fmt"

type Shape interface {
    Area() float64
}

type Circle struct {
    Radius float64
}

func (c Circle) Area() float64 {
    return 3.14 * c.Radius * c.Radius
}

func main() {
    var s Shape
    s = Circle{Radius: 5}
    circle, ok := s.(Circle)
    if !ok {
        fmt.Println("類型斷言失敗")
        return
    }
    fmt.Println(circle.Area())
}

上面的代碼中,通過將接口轉換為具體類型,并判斷轉換是否成功。

通過以上介紹,讀者可以更好地理解和掌握Golang中數據轉換的核心技術。掌握這些技術后,讀者可以輕松應對各種數據轉換場景,提高程序的性能和穩定性。希朁本文的內容對讀者有所幫助。

相關推薦

  • 了解Go語言在大數據處理領域的應用場景

    了解Go語言在大數據處理領域的應用場景

    隨著大數據時代的來臨,對于數據處理效率和速度的要求越來越高。在處理海量數據時,選擇適合的編程語言和工具顯得尤為重要。Go語言作為一門高效、簡潔、并發的編程語言,逐漸在大數據處理領域嶄露頭角。本文將探討

    綜合教程 2024-02-24 18:44:29 175
  • 如何安全地存儲數據庫連接詳細信息

    如何安全地存儲數據庫連接詳細信息

    問題內容在需要打開數據庫連接的應用程序中,必須將用戶名/密碼詳細信息發送到數據庫。存儲和使用這些數據最安全的方式是什么?正確答案確切的方法取決于環境,但一般來說,您將憑據存儲在只有運行應用程序的用戶可

    綜合教程 2024-02-24 18:44:01 147
  • 深入探索Go語言在大數據處理中的應用

    深入探索Go語言在大數據處理中的應用

    在當今信息爆炸的時代,大數據處理已成為各行各業必不可少的一項技術。為了高效地處理龐大的數據量,程序員們紛紛尋求各種新的編程語言和工具。其中,Go語言以其高效的并發性能和簡潔的語法,逐漸成為了大數據處理

    綜合教程 2024-02-24 18:43:58 192
  • 連接字符串導致問題

    連接字符串導致問題

    問題內容我在 python 中遇到了一些與連接字符串相關的奇怪問題。我們有一個需求,需要通過api連接到外部數據源并提取數據。通過 api 連接時,我們需要以字符串形式將各種憑據作為 raw_data

    綜合教程 2024-02-24 18:43:42 79
  • 對Go語言中的數組數據結構進行深入分析

    對Go語言中的數組數據結構進行深入分析

    數組數據結構:數組是一種基本的數據結構,它包含一系列元素,每個元素都有一個索引。數組中的元素可以是任何類型,包括其他數組。數組的大小在創建時確定,并且在以后不能改變。代碼示例:// 創建一個包含 5

    綜合教程 2024-02-05 12:37:09 172
久久久亚洲精品石原莉奈| 成人精品网站在线观看| 欧美成人午夜激情在线| 国产精华一区二区三区| 亚洲最大成人在线观看| 久久综合久久色| 精品在线免费观看视频| 日韩在线电影| 久久亚洲不卡| 五月婷婷综合网| www.日韩av.com| 日本电影一区二区三区| 成人做爰www看视频软件| 国产又粗又长又黄| 精品国产一区二区三区香蕉沈先生 | av亚洲精华国产精华| 欧美日韩免费高清一区色橹橹| 欧美一区二区影院| 波多野结衣综合网| 欧美丰满艳妇bbwbbw| 九九热这里有精品| 日韩成人精品在线| 91久久人澡人人添人人爽欧美 | 黄色精品视频| 久久精品一区二区国产| 午夜精品久久久久影视| 国产精品美女在线| 在线观看免费黄网站| 久久久久久久久网站| 91久久极品少妇xxxxⅹ软件| 超碰av在线免费观看| 久久黄色精品视频| 亚洲制服欧美另类| 久久久久亚洲蜜桃| 九九久久精品一区| av在线免费观看国产| 人妻久久一区二区| 红杏成人性视频免费看| 蜜臀精品久久久久久蜜臀| 色琪琪一区二区三区亚洲区| 亚洲影院高清在线| 亚洲av无一区二区三区久久| 成人h动漫精品一区二区无码| 欧美成人高清| 亚洲国产中文字幕在线视频综合| 久久久久在线观看| 久久国产亚洲精品无码| 一二三区免费视频| 日韩情爱电影在线观看| 亚洲视频免费看| 欧美国产乱视频| 91精品91久久久中77777老牛| 69国产精品视频免费观看| 精品精品久久| 欧美性精品220| 成人h视频在线| 天天干天天操天天拍| 久久精品黄色| 久久众筹精品私拍模特| 中文字幕欧美日韩在线| 2021国产视频| 国产91国语对白在线| 国产日韩1区| 欧美日韩一本到| 国产二区不卡| 久久精品国产亚洲AV无码麻豆 | 夜夜亚洲天天久久| 热久久免费国产视频| 校园春色 亚洲色图| 视频在线日韩| 成人免费黄色在线| 深夜福利一区二区| 少妇无码av无码专区在线观看| 嫩草影院一区二区| 另类欧美日韩国产在线| 亚洲护士老师的毛茸茸最新章节| 亚洲精品自在在线观看| 日本在线观看视频网站| 亚洲无中文字幕| 欧美日韩中文字幕在线视频| 久久人人97超碰人人澡爱香蕉| 青青操在线视频观看| 四虎884aa成人精品最新| 1000部国产精品成人观看| 68精品久久久久久欧美| 黄色片免费网址| 亚洲mmav| 日韩理论片在线| 成人免费视频观看视频| 国产午夜精品久久久久| 国内精品伊人久久久久av影院| 亚洲人在线视频| 日本黄大片在线观看| 特黄视频在线观看| 成人深夜福利app| 8050国产精品久久久久久| 在线视频第一页| 欧美做受69| 亚洲在线中文字幕| 区一区二区三区中文字幕| 一区二区三区日| 免费人成精品欧美精品| 欧美精品亚州精品| 成人精品在线观看视频| 国产精品对白久久久久粗| 日本道精品一区二区三区| 成人短视频在线看| 亚洲网站免费观看| 久草热8精品视频在线观看| 国产亚洲美女久久| 亚洲综合在线网站| 亚洲日本中文字幕在线| 99久久伊人久久99| 成人性生交xxxxx网站| 日韩成人一区二区三区| 精品一区二区三区在线播放视频| …久久精品99久久香蕉国产| 久久精品亚洲a| 日韩影院在线观看| 97精品免费视频| jlzzjizz在线播放观看| 欧美调教视频| 欧美电影免费提供在线观看| 97久久国产亚洲精品超碰热| av中文字幕观看| 成人免费视频免费观看| 国产色视频一区| 欧美黑人猛猛猛| 男男成人高潮片免费网站| 国内精品久久久久| 多男操一女视频| 老司机精品视频在线| 日本老师69xxx| 亚洲午夜久久久久久久国产| 亚洲精品精选| 国产亚洲精品美女久久久| 免费黄色三级网站| 精品国产欧美日韩| 国产视频久久久久久久| 色片在线免费观看| 欧美手机在线| 欧美一区二区私人影院日本| 欧美在线观看视频免费| 国产精品亚洲综合在线观看| 亚洲一区二区视频| 欧美一级黄色录像片| 成人爽a毛片一区二区| 久久久精品tv| 久久伦理网站| 亚洲欧美日韩动漫| 欧美性猛交xxxx富婆| 免费在线观看的av网站| 国产精品777777在线播放| 欧美亚洲精品一区| av动漫在线免费观看| 精品三级久久久| 天天影视涩香欲综合网| 日本一区二区精品| 亚洲天堂一区二区| 亚洲欧美日韩成人高清在线一区| 久99久视频| 成人影院大全| 亚洲最大成人网4388xx| 亚洲中文字幕无码一区二区三区| 亚洲欧美日本国产| 在线免费不卡视频| 日产精品久久久久久久蜜臀| 成午夜精品一区二区三区软件| 一本色道久久加勒比精品| 免费观看黄色的网站| 日本免费一区二区视频| 色综合色狠狠综合色| 黄色片久久久久| 欧美三级三级| 精品国偷自产在线| 日韩人妻一区二区三区| 亚洲私拍自拍| 久久视频在线看| 阿v天堂2014| 国产最新精品免费| 粉嫩高清一区二区三区精品视频| 人妻中文字幕一区| 欧美午夜宅男影院| 深夜福利网站在线观看| 不卡在线一区二区| 久久黄色av网站| 国产在线一区视频| 国产日产欧美一区二区视频| 国产一区喷水| 亚洲欧美国产高清va在线播放| 婷婷久久综合九色综合伊人色| 亚洲乱码中文字幕久久孕妇黑人| 国产精品毛片久久| 在线播放国产一区中文字幕剧情欧美| 国产十八熟妇av成人一区| 三级欧美韩日大片在线看| 成人国产精品色哟哟| 人妻无码中文字幕| 欧美日韩亚洲综合在线 | 老鸭窝毛片一区二区三区| 国产精品老女人视频| 午夜精品久久久久久久99老熟妇| 色欧美片视频在线观看在线视频| 在线观看免费看片| 日本成人在线不卡视频| 2019中文字幕在线| 91精品国产色综合久久不8| 亚洲成人av免费| 2018中文字幕第一页| 亚洲国产精品免费视频| 亚洲欧美国产一区二区三区 | 中文字幕在线观看成人| 久久久精品免费观看| 男人添女人下部视频免费| 日韩电影免费网址| 91禁外国网站| 午夜久久久久久噜噜噜噜| 欧美在线视频你懂得| 污片免费在线观看| 国产激情视频一区二区三区欧美| 国产日韩欧美综合| 成人av三级| 欧美成人综合网站| 91精品少妇一区二区三区蜜桃臀| 久久久久久久久岛国免费| 久青草视频在线播放| 偷拍欧美精品| 国产一区玩具在线观看| 精品日本视频| 亚洲欧洲在线观看| 亚洲精品1区2区3区| 亚洲国产欧美一区二区三区丁香婷| 国产区二区三区| 秋霞电影一区二区| 欧美一区免费视频| 亚洲老女人视频免费| 久久久久国产精品www| 精品人妻一区二区三区含羞草| 欧美日韩成人在线一区| 亚洲精品一区二区三区影院忠贞| 91视频免费播放| 亚洲国产精品日韩| av中文字幕一区二区| 欧美在线激情网| 亚洲欧美日韩综合在线| 精品一区二区三区三区| www欧美在线| 成人欧美一区二区三区白人| 色婷婷狠狠18| 麻豆高清免费国产一区| 亚洲国产一区二区精品视频| 91亚洲国产| 国语自产精品视频在线看一大j8 | 国产精品一二三四| 国产一区二区三区四区五区在线| a看欧美黄色女同性恋| 久久免费国产视频| 天天摸天天碰天天爽天天弄| 亚洲国产日韩欧美在线动漫| 久久不卡免费视频| 色综合天天综合| 舐め犯し波多野结衣在线观看| 国产真实乱对白精彩久久| 国产日韩欧美二区| 欧美日韩麻豆| 国产精品高潮呻吟久久av无限| 国内精品偷拍视频| 精品999在线播放| 男女全黄做爰文章| 2019国产精品| 日韩免费毛片视频| 美女久久久精品| av中文字幕av| 国产精品美女久久久| 欧美一级二级三级| 一区二区在线免费播放| 97视频在线观看免费| 中韩乱幕日产无线码一区| 久久精品国产一区二区三区| 成人av手机在线| 亚洲老头同性xxxxx| 91精品国产乱码久久久| 亚洲的天堂在线中文字幕| 中文字幕乱码av| 亚洲超碰精品一区二区| 亚洲久久久久久久| 亚洲欧美成人一区二区三区| 漂亮人妻被黑人久久精品| 国产欧美日韩三级| 日韩精品视频久久| 美国毛片一区二区| 97中文字幕在线| 日日欢夜夜爽一区| 欧美a级免费视频| 奇米影视7777精品一区二区| 天堂а√在线中文在线| 久久精品日韩欧美| 中文字幕日韩精品无码内射| 首页亚洲欧美制服丝腿| 亚洲色图都市激情| 日韩成人一级片| www.欧美黄色| 久久精品999| 免费无码不卡视频在线观看| 狠狠狠色丁香婷婷综合激情 | 国产精品丝袜视频| 国产一区二区主播在线| 色综合久久久久久中文网| 日韩不卡免费高清视频| 欧美激情在线有限公司| 精品福利在线| 日本国产一区二区三区| 中文字幕日韩在线| 国产精品视频99| 国产精品欧美在线观看| 奇米4444一区二区三区| 日韩精品一区国产| 国产精品自在线| 九色精品91| 国产精品久久久久久久久久东京| 福利欧美精品在线| 亚洲最大福利视频网| 清纯唯美亚洲综合一区| 精品国产乱码一区二区三区四区| 性欧美lx╳lx╳| 99re在线视频观看| 欧洲亚洲视频| yy111111少妇影院日韩夜片| 久久福利影院| 午夜视频久久久| 91精品一区二区三区综合| 亚洲va欧美va国产综合剧情| 日韩免费视频| 日韩av高清| 午夜精品毛片| 亚洲欧美丝袜| 免费观看成人鲁鲁鲁鲁鲁视频| 逼特逼视频在线| 91在线视频观看| 天堂av在线网站| 国产无遮挡一区二区三区毛片日本| 国产精品无码在线| 五月综合激情婷婷六月色窝| 精品无码人妻一区二区三| 欧美不卡123| 欧美一区二区三区网站| 亚洲美女激情视频| 欧美黄色三级| 国产精品久久电影观看| 残酷重口调教一区二区| 日韩国产一区久久| 免费成人在线观看| 亚洲一区日韩精品| 91天堂素人约啪| 国产ts丝袜人妖系列视频| 欧美性xxxx在线播放| 国产91国语对白在线| 中文字幕日韩专区| 99亚洲男女激情在线观看| 午夜精品久久久久久久99热| 国产欧美自拍一区| 欧美大陆一区二区| 女人色偷偷aa久久天堂| 在线观看18视频网站| 国产成a人无v码亚洲福利| 免费看a级黄色片| 国产精品系列在线| 艳妇乳肉豪妇荡乳xxx| 欧美色视频日本版| 看黄色一级大片| 亚洲丁香婷深爱综合| 国产又爽又黄网站亚洲视频123| 日韩av电影院| 久久久久午夜电影| 欧美成人高潮一二区在线看| 久久理论电影网| 日本 欧美 国产| 亚洲成av人乱码色午夜| 秋霞国产精品| 亚洲最大的免费| 免费在线观看成人av| avove在线观看| 成年人国产精品| 91av免费观看| 精品美女久久久久久免费| www.亚洲激情| 亚洲色图色老头| 精品亚洲二区| 鲁鲁视频www一区二区| 激情六月婷婷久久| 亚洲av成人片色在线观看高潮| 欧美系列在线观看| 免费看国产片在线观看| 国产男人精品视频| 99在线观看免费视频精品观看| 国产三级中文字幕| 久久综合九色综合97_久久久| 成人欧美一区二区三区黑人一| 亚洲精品电影在线| 成人污污www网站免费丝瓜|